THESIS, The main argument or central idea that an author tries to prove in a written work., EDITORIAL, A newspaper or magazine article that expresses the opinion of the editor or publisher on a current issue., STANCE, The position or viewpoint an author takes regarding a particular issue or topic., CONCISENESS, The quality of being brief, clear, and efficient in writing or speaking., EVIDENCE, Facts, data, or information used to support or prove a claim or thesis statement., PERSUADE, To successfully convince someone to believe something or to take a certain action through reasoning or argument., FOUNDATION, The underlying principle or basis upon which a claim or structure of writing is built., ARGUMENT, A set of reasons presented with the aim of persuading others that an action or idea is right or wrong., ISSUE, An important topic or problem for debate or discussion in society., CLARITY, The quality of being easy to understand and free from confusion.
